This early Yamaha "Nippon Gakki" model is one of the coveted classical guitars that was manufactured in the company's Tenryu/Wada factory in 1968 (the company only made these guitars for 3 years.)
Despite being initially sold as cheap bargain-priced guitars, these used models typically now sell for much more because of their stunning range of rich sound, volume, and tone.
